Modern technology's Role in Authenticity and Security
In a market where credibility is critical, modern technology is stepping up to the plate. Blockchain is being used to develop tamper-proof documents of provenance, while high-resolution imaging and spectroscopy tools assist discover imitations. These improvements make sure that the job of fine art appraisers remains legitimate and reputable, especially when taking care of high-value deals.
Additionally, these technologies are altering how items are insured, stored, and transferred. The conventional art market's dependence on paper-based systems is swiftly being replaced with safe and secure digital methods, producing smoother and extra safe processes for enthusiasts and organizations alike.

The Hybrid Model of Auctions
Physical auction gallery occasions are not going anywhere, yet they're being improved by electronic tools. Hybrid auctions-- which combine in-person and on-line bidding-- are becoming the standard. This approach not only enhances access however likewise broadens the purchaser base, bringing in worldwide interest and younger tech-savvy participants.
This crossbreed version additionally affects prices trends and bidding actions. The from this source ease of on-line bidding and real-time analytics allows auction residences to plan with greater accuracy. This vibrant landscape benefits those who are quick to adjust, and art appraisers are progressively associated with pre-auction to ensure reasonable and precise evaluations.
